anyone know what this means "your client is a leaf node shielded by and utrapeer" got this on the monitor screen

It means that you are a leaf and are only connected to 3-4 "ultrapeer" computers. Ultrapeers are just normal computers running a Gnutella client, but typically with lots of bandwidth and resources. Ultrapeers are usually connected to around 50 leaves and handle all their searches and incoming queries. You only handle your own. This saves you much bandwidth and system resources. This also means that the Statistics window is a complete lie, unless you're an ultrapeer (even still not very accurate).

So, in turn, you only get incoming queries that the Ultrapeer is forwarding to you, which always match with a file you have. If you share no files (freeload) then you get no incoming queries in the monitor box. If you share a few hundred files, you'll get plenty of incoming queries. Hope this clears it up.
